2020/21 CRCNA Annual Report

The 2020/21 CRCNA Annual Report provides an overview of the organisation's research activities and highlights for the year 1 July 2020 - 30 June 2021.

Some highlights include:

  • $10.9 million in participant co-contributions committed to research collaborations
  • 18 new research projects contracted in 20/21
  • $7.9 million of CRCNA funding committed towards these projects 
  • 4 co-funding agreements with industry Research and Development Corporations
  • 18 PhD embedded students 
  • 15 student scholarships awards (PhD, Masters and Undergraduate)
